In 1967 McCain was shot down over Vietnam, his leg and both arms were broken, the VC got to him and smashed his shoulder with a rifle butt and stuck a bayonet into his foot. Over the next 5 and a half years he was beaten and tortured, his wounds were not treated and he wasn't expected to live. When they found out he was the son of an admiral he got better treatment and was forced to make a propaganda video denouncing the US. 

Trump got student deferments and a medical deferment for a foot thing, he then didn't get called up when they introduced the Vietnam lottery in 1969.
